This community is best suited for older adults who prize daily social engagement and a genuinely caring, family-like care team. Salem North Healthcare Center tends to attract residents who thrive on structured activities, friendly interactions, and visible administrator accessibility. In practice, the setting often feels welcoming, with a small-town atmosphere that supports regular updates to families and a sense that staff know residents well. For seniors who value companionship, consistent activity programming, and a homey feel, this facility can deliver meaningful quality of life and a credible sense of being cared about.
However, alternatives should be seriously considered by families prioritizing rigorous rehab outcomes, stringent safety standards, or highly specialized memory care. Several reviews flag acute concerns about consistency of care, laundry and hygiene practices, and overall safety. If a loved one requires intensive wound care, precise medication management, or 24/7 medical oversight, the facility's mixed reliability on staffing and responses could pose unacceptable risk. Those who need a modern, private-room experience or a facility with ironclad protocol for dementia care may find better alignment elsewhere.
The strongest pros center on human connection and activity-driven living. When staff are attentive, residents feel listened to, and families are kept in the loop, care quality improves markedly. Administrators who engage with residents and guests alike amplify a sense of trust and accountability. The activity program, including off-site outings, group games, and social events, adds meaningful structure that can offset the monotony of long-term care. Nutritious meals and around-the-clock access to snacks also appear consistently positive, reinforcing a supportive daily rhythm for those who value companionship and engagement.
Yet the cons carry substantial weight. A substantial number of reviews recount at least episodic neglect, odor and cleanliness issues, and equipment that feels outdated or poorly maintained. Reports include delays in nurse responses, missed or incorrect medications, and a pattern of understaffing that can leave residents waiting for assistance. Shared rooms and cramped spaces undermine privacy and comfort, and some families describe disturbing lapses in personal hygiene and dignity. The combination of these factors - especially safety lapses and inconsistent clinical oversight - creates a volatile risk profile for residents with higher care needs.
Decision-making becomes a question of balancing the tangible warmth with the real-world gaps in care delivery. Prospective families should insist on seeing concrete evidence of staffing levels during peak hours, request a tour of a resident room at typical visiting times, and review a current therapy schedule to determine if rehabilitation intensity matches expectations. Engage with multiple staff members, including the administrator and charge nurses, to gauge consistency of communication and follow-through on family concerns. Check how memory care is managed, and probe for safety measures that address wandering, fall prevention, and post-surgical recovery routines.
In the end, Salem North Healthcare Center can be a good fit for families who prize a welcoming environment, active social life, and a responsive, personable staff - provided those positives are weighed against serious cautions about consistency, cleanliness, and medical oversight. For families where rehab outcomes, strict infection control, and unambiguous daily care are non-negotiable, stronger alternatives should be explored. The facility is not a universally risky choice, but its appeal is highly contingent on individual needs and on who is willing to advocate vigorously for a loved one. A careful, on-site evaluation is essential before committing.
Salem North Healthcare Center in Salem, OH is an assisted living community that offers a wide range of amenities and care services to meet the needs and preferences of its residents. The community is equipped with a beauty salon, where residents can enjoy various grooming and beauty services. Each resident has access to cable or satellite TV for entertainment and relaxation purposes.
Transportation is made easy with the availability of community-operated transportation as well as transportation arrangement services. Residents can easily get around town or go for their doctor's appointments without any hassle. The computer center provides residents with access to technology, allowing them to stay connected with family and friends or engage in online activities.
The dining room offers restaurant-style dining, where residents can enjoy delicious meals prepared by the community's staff. Special dietary restrictions are also taken into consideration, ensuring that each resident's specific dietary needs are met. For those who prefer cooking their own meals, there is a kitchenette available in each fully furnished apartment.
To promote physical wellness, the community offers a fitness room and various fitness programs that residents can participate in. Additionally, there is a wellness center available for residents to focus on maintaining their overall health.
Social interaction and engagement are encouraged within the community through activities such as resident-run activities, scheduled daily activities, planned day trips, and concierge services. These activities aim to keep residents active, stimulated, and connected with others.
Salem North Healthcare Center prioritizes the safety and well-being of its residents by providing 24-hour call system monitoring and supervision. Assistance with daily living tasks such as bathing, dressing, and transfers is readily available when needed. Medication management services ensure that residents receive their required medications on time.
The community's convenient location means that there are several nearby amenities including c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, places of worship, and hospitals. This allows for easy access to essential services and enjoyable outings within the local area.
Overall, Salem North Healthcare Center offers a comfortable and enriching living environment, where residents can receive comprehensive care services while enjoying a variety of amenities and engaging in fulfilling activities.
